Address 0 PPC

PWjT61tccj7mjVZ948R7oo8HKDcgsYRY8A

Confirmed

Total Received1608.754568 PPC
Total Sent1608.754568 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PWjT61tccj7mjVZ948R7oo8HKDcgsYRY8A1608.754568 PPC
Fee: 0.01 PPC
687798 Confirmations1608.744568 PPC
PWjT61tccj7mjVZ948R7oo8HKDcgsYRY8A1608.754568 PPC
PRXeWJYfULtTJcAzgTo8R5wvL71E9dTEMo15.882121 PPC
Fee: 0.01 PPC
687798 Confirmations1624.636689 PPC